What exactly is the Accountability & Credibility Plan, and what is its purpose?
The Accountability & Credibility Plan is basically a set of criteria that the college’s Continuing Education and Basic Skills programs must adhere to in order to ensure proper use of public funds. The Plan, which is required by the State Board of Community Colleges, is a system of checks and balances designed to achieve a quality-learning environment as well as institutional effectiveness and efficiencies in the management of continuing education programs.
